Oscar Rodriguez serves as President of the Texas Association of Broadcasters, a statewide, non-profit advocacy organization for the state’s 1,200+ free, over-the-air local radio and television stations.

A graduate of the University of Texas at Austin, Rodriguez began his career in public service as an Assistant Press Secretary to Gov. Mark White from 1984 to 1987.

He then served a seven-year stint as a legislative liaison for the Texas Education Agency before joining TAB in 1994.

He is a native Texan who grew up in McAllen and has lived in Austin since 1981.
